diff options
| author | Kubernetes Prow Robot <k8s-ci-robot@users.noreply.github.com> | 2019-12-15 17:39:37 -0800 |
|---|---|---|
| committer | GitHub <noreply@github.com> | 2019-12-15 17:39:37 -0800 |
| commit | b8080af21f7157a140f3784ca9264bd00ac33f94 (patch) | |
| tree | 9abee7d40dbef814c22394552d2b0b88de2a1ced /contributors/guide | |
| parent | 9ce7024e10d001d8c3c60a25bad3f7c037c33b3c (diff) | |
| parent | a835e357bfef20f6816fad308302e97d02f14361 (diff) | |
Merge pull request #4282 from saschagrunert/release-notes-review
Add release notes review section
Diffstat (limited to 'contributors/guide')
| -rw-r--r-- | contributors/guide/release-notes.md | 16 |
1 files changed, 16 insertions, 0 deletions
diff --git a/contributors/guide/release-notes.md b/contributors/guide/release-notes.md index 32d7160a..3c68e085 100644 --- a/contributors/guide/release-notes.md +++ b/contributors/guide/release-notes.md @@ -76,6 +76,22 @@ To see how to format your release notes, view the kubernetes/kubernetes [pull re Release notes apply to pull requests on the master branch. For patch release branches the automated cherry-pick pull requests process (see the [cherry-pick instructions](/contributors/devel/sig-release/cherry-picks.md)) should be followed. That automation will pull release notes from the master branch PR from which the cherry-pick originated. On a rare occasion a pull request on a patch release branch is not a cherry-pick, but rather is targeted directly to the non-master branch and in this case, a `release-note-*` label is required for that non-master pull request. +## Reviewing Release Notes + +Reviewing the release notes of a pull request should be a dedicated step in the +overall review process. It is necessary to rely on the same metrics as other +reviewers to be able to distinguish release notes which might need to be +rephrased. + +As a guideline, a release notes entry needs to be rephrased if one of the +following cases apply: + +- The release note does not communicate the full purpose of the change. +- The release note has no impact on any user. +- The release note is grammatically incorrect. + +In any other case the release note should be fine. + ## Related * [Behind The Scenes: Kubernetes Release Notes Tips & Tricks - Mike Arpaia, Kolide (KubeCon 2018 Lightning Talk)](https://www.youtube.com/watch?v=n62oPohOyYs) |
